Cultural and Historical Context of Elegance
The concept of elegance has evolved across cultures and throughout history. Ancient Greek and Roman civilizations emphasized symmetry and balance in their attire and architecture, reflecting a deep appreciation for aesthetics. The Renaissance saw a rise in elaborate courtly attire, showcasing wealth and status. The 18th and 19th centuries witnessed the development of distinct societal codes of elegance, with women embodying grace and refinement.

Color Selection for Sophistication
Selecting colors that exude sophistication involves a combination of understanding color theory, considering personal preferences, and paying attention to the overall effect on the wearer. Neutral colors like black, navy, gray, and beige often serve as a foundation for elegance, allowing other colors to stand out and complement the wearer. However, the versatility of these colors does not diminish the need to thoughtfully consider their shade and tone.
For example, a deep navy blue can evoke a sense of authority, whereas a lighter shade might suggest a more casual feel.
Examples of Elegant Color Palettes
Elegant color palettes frequently incorporate a harmonious blend of colors. Monochromatic palettes, using variations of a single color, create a streamlined and sophisticated look. Analogous palettes, featuring colors adjacent to each other on the color wheel, offer a sense of harmony and balance. Complementary palettes, using colors opposite each other on the color wheel, can be striking and dynamic, but require careful consideration to avoid clashing.

Body Shape and Elegance
Understanding your body shape is crucial for creating a truly elegant look. It’s not about conforming to a specific ideal, but rather about accentuating your best features and strategically concealing areas you’d prefer to downplay. This tailored approach allows you to feel confident and stylish, regardless of your physique.
Tailoring Outfits to Different Body Shapes
Choosing garments that flatter your specific body type is paramount to achieving an elegant silhouette. Analyzing your body’s proportions – the relative lengths and widths of different parts – helps identify the best styles to highlight your assets. This involves identifying your natural waistline, shoulder width, and hip circumference, among other key measurements. An understanding of these proportions is key to creating an outfit that enhances your figure and provides a well-balanced aesthetic.
Clothing Styles to Enhance Body Types
Appropriate clothing styles can significantly enhance different body types. For example, a-line dresses, flowing skirts, and well-fitted tops are frequently flattering for those with an hourglass figure, drawing attention to the natural waist and curves. Similarly, structured jackets, well-tailored pants, and V-neck tops can be beneficial for pear-shaped figures, balancing the silhouette and drawing focus to the upper body.
Importance of Understanding Body Proportions
A comprehensive understanding of body proportions is essential to crafting a harmonious and flattering silhouette. This involves recognizing the relationship between different body parts, such as the bust, waist, and hips, and how clothing can be used to emphasize or de-emphasize these areas. Consider the length of your torso, the width of your shoulders, and the placement of your natural waistline.
This detailed understanding enables you to select outfits that strategically highlight your assets and create a more balanced visual impression.
Clothing Styles for Different Body Shapes
Body Shape | Clothing Style Suggestions | Enhancement Focus | Example Outfit Ideas |
---|---|---|---|
Hourglass | Fitted tops, A-line dresses, wrap dresses, flowing skirts | Waist definition, curves | A fitted black top paired with an A-line floral midi skirt, or a wrap dress in a bold print |
Pear | Structured jackets, well-tailored pants, V-neck tops, fitted blazers | Balancing upper and lower body, highlighting the shoulders | A tailored blazer over a fitted top and straight-leg pants, or a V-neck sweater with high-waisted trousers |
Rectangle | Fitted jackets, V-necks, belts, and tailored pieces | Creating a waistline, highlighting the bust | A fitted blazer with a tucked-in shirt, or a V-neck top with a belt cinching the waist |
Inverted Triangle | A-line dresses, flowing tops, and skirts, belts | Balancing shoulders and hips, highlighting the waist | A flowing top with an A-line skirt, or a belted dress that balances the upper body with the lower body |

Lighting and Arrangement
Strategic lighting is critical in enhancing an elegant ambiance. Layered lighting, combining ambient, task, and accent lighting, creates depth and dimension. Ambient lighting provides overall illumination, while task lighting focuses on specific areas for functionality. Accent lighting highlights architectural details and artwork, drawing attention to specific points of interest. The arrangement of furniture and accessories influences the flow and visual appeal of the space.
